Planning Your Visit

Cash for Entry

Be prepared to pay a $5 cash-only fee for access. Some visitors have reported issues with change, so having exact or small bills is recommended. This fee helps maintain the reservoir as a clean watershed.

Watercraft Rules

Motorized boats are prohibited to protect the watershed. Only kayaks, canoes, and small sailboats are permitted. Paddleboarding is also not allowed, so confirm your watercraft plans before you go.

Kayaking and Watercraft at Little Dell Reservoir

Little Dell Reservoir is a prime spot for kayaking, canoeing, and small sailboats due to its strict policy against motorized boats. This ensures a peaceful experience free from disruptive wakes, engine noise, and fumes. Visitors appreciate the calm waters, making it ideal for a relaxing day out on the lake. InstagramReddit

There are two hand-launch ramps: one on the east and one on the west side. The east ramp is often noted as being better shaded, though it might be a slightly longer walk to the water's edge. It's important to remember that paddleboarding is not permitted here, so ensure your watercraft aligns with the reservoir's regulations. Reddit

While the lack of motorized craft is a major draw, some kayakers have noted that fishermen often crowd the banks, requiring careful navigation to avoid fishing lines. Despite this, the absence of speed boats and loud music contributes significantly to the reservoir's tranquil atmosphere, making it a favored destination for those seeking a quiet escape. Reddit

Fishing Regulations and Tips

For anglers, Little Dell Reservoir offers the chance to catch large fish, though with specific regulations. The key rule to remember is that only artificial lures are allowed; live bait is strictly prohibited to maintain the water's purity as a watershed. Reddit

Some visitors have found that fish tend to stay deeper in the water, particularly during warmer months, suggesting that early mornings or late evenings might be more productive times for fishing. Patience and the right techniques are key to a successful outing here. Reddit

While the fishing itself can be rewarding, be aware that the banks can be crowded with other anglers, which might limit space for setting up a picnic or easily launching and landing your kayak. Nevertheless, the opportunity to fish in such a scenic and protected environment is a significant draw for many. Reddit
